Building Systems Integration

The Building Systems Integration research program at NC State was established in 1986. The mission is to research how design can improve health and energy performances of the built environment and to develop integrated building systems that involve daylighting, structural, mechanical,  interior furnishings, and outdoor environmental elements. 

The research group is led by Dr. Wayne Place and Dr. Jianxin Hu.
